在数字化时代,云计算已经成为企业构建IT基础设施的重要组成部分。随着云服务的多样化,企业往往会选择多云战略来规避单点故障,提升服务的可靠性和灵活性。然而,多云环境也带来了资源管理和调度上的挑战。本文将揭秘跨云调度的秘密,探讨如何实现多云环境下的高效资源管理。
多云环境的挑战
资源孤岛
在多云环境中,不同云服务商提供的资源类型、接口和定价策略存在差异,导致资源之间难以互通,形成资源孤岛。
成本管理
由于缺乏统一的管理和优化策略,企业在多云环境下往往面临资源利用率低、成本高昂的问题。
安全合规
多云环境下,数据安全和合规性问题更加复杂,企业需要确保在不同云环境中都能满足相应的安全标准和合规要求。
跨云调度的核心
跨云调度旨在通过智能化的策略,实现多云环境下的资源优化和自动化管理。以下为跨云调度的核心要素:
1. 资源监控
实时监控多云环境中各个云服务商的资源使用情况,包括CPU、内存、存储等关键指标。
2. 资源评估
根据业务需求,评估不同云服务商的资源性价比,选择最合适的云服务商和资源类型。
3. 自动化迁移
利用自动化工具,将应用和数据进行迁移,实现多云环境下的无缝切换。
4. 弹性伸缩
根据业务负载动态调整资源,实现按需分配,降低成本。
实现高效资源管理的策略
1. 统一资源视图
构建统一的多云资源视图,使企业能够全面了解多云环境中的资源情况。
2. 智能调度策略
制定智能的调度策略,实现资源自动分配、迁移和伸缩。
3. 风险管理
建立完善的风险管理机制,确保多云环境下的数据安全和合规。
4. 培训与协作
加强云服务团队的专业技能培训,提高团队在多云环境下的协作能力。
跨云调度的技术实现
1. 开源工具
开源工具如Terraform、Kubernetes等,可以用于多云资源的自动化管理和调度。
2. 商业解决方案
商业解决方案如Amazon Web Services (AWS)、Microsoft Azure等,提供跨云调度的工具和服务。
3. 自研平台
企业可以自主研发跨云调度平台,以满足自身特定的需求。
案例分析
某大型互联网企业采用多云战略,通过引入跨云调度平台,实现了以下成果:
- 资源利用率提升20%
- 成本降低30%
- 应用性能提升10%
总结
跨云调度是多云环境下的重要解决方案,通过合理规划和实施,可以有效提升多云环境下的资源管理和调度效率。企业应结合自身业务需求,选择合适的跨云调度技术和策略,实现多云环境下的高效资源管理。
